On 14 May 2024, at 08:38, Patrick Dupre via users <users@lists.fedoraproject.org> wrote:
 
How can I fix it without currently resizing /boot?
 
 
How big is your /boot? What does this report? df -h /boot
 
If its 1GB then that should be lots of space and its worth checking where the space has been used up.
Have a look with ncdu or du to see what directories are taking up the space.
There have been people that reported full /boot and found unexpected backup files in there.
